Position Summary:
The primary purpose of your job is to coordinate with the interdisciplinary healthcare team to provide comprehensive care and support for residents with dementia and/or dementia-related conditions. You will plan, organize, implement, and oversee specialized dementia programming that aligns with best practices in cognitive wellness. This position supports the overall goals of enhancing the emotional, cognitive, physical, and social well-being of each resident through structured, individualized, and compassionate programming.
Education/Qualifications:
Certified Occupational Therapy Assistant (COTA) preferred. May consider Associate or Bachelor’s degree in Human Services, Nursing, Occupational Therapy, Recreational Therapy, or a related field.
Current certification as a Dementia Practitioner preferred or ability to obtain within six (6) months of hire.
Minimum of two (2) years of experience in long-term care or memory care programming as a Certified Occupational Therapy Assistant (COTA) or other discipline as noted above.
